From: Stephan Bosch Date: Tue, 30 Oct 2018 08:53:07 +0000 (+0100) Subject: submission: relay backend: Add assertion in backend_relay_handle_relay_reply() to... X-Git-Tag: 2.3.9~1112 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=f996eb545cc3fa83c9ae4e0b2274a1e646cdefe2;p=thirdparty%2Fdovecot%2Fcore.git submission: relay backend: Add assertion in backend_relay_handle_relay_reply() to address compiler warning. Assert that the error message is assinged when the result is FALSE. --- diff --git a/src/submission/submission-backend-relay.c b/src/submission/submission-backend-relay.c index f68191d689..505253a816 100644 --- a/src/submission/submission-backend-relay.c +++ b/src/submission/submission-backend-relay.c @@ -91,6 +91,8 @@ backend_relay_handle_relay_reply(struct submission_backend_relay *backend, if (!result) { const char *detail = "", *reason; + i_assert(msg != NULL); + switch (reply->status) { case SMTP_CLIENT_COMMAND_ERROR_ABORTED: i_unreached();